Youth Ministry Excuse #3 But I’m Not…

I’m not __________________ (Good enough, smart enough, etc.) A poor self image is an incubator for excuses. Consider Gideon, the Lord came to him and wanted to choose him for great things. He responded with My clan is the weakest I am the least God always sees more in you than you see in yourself.…
